What you read matters.
So we hire people who care deeply about reading and writing.
Subscriptions are better than ads.
The business model matters – subscriptions put readers and writers in charge, and they create an incentive system that fosters great work.
We work in service of writers.
Our teams build both for and with writers, providing Substack writers with the best terms, services, tools, and programs on offer.
We believe in the free press and in free speech.
We do not believe these things can be decoupled. You can read more about our views on content moderation on our blog.

We offer robust benefits, though many companies will offer you those. So we offer an even more unique opportunity: the chance to materially affect the financial security of independent writers around the world.
Remote work support
All employees receive a generous allowance to customize their home offices.
Comprehensive health care
Substack covers 100% of premiums for employees and their dependents, and fully funds HRA plans.
Parental leave
We want employees to be fully present for the new members of their family, so we offer generous parental leave.
Flexible vacation and paid time off
You’re the best person to decide when you need a day—or a week—off to travel or decompress. Our flexible vacation policy puts you in control.
Company holidays and Winter shutdown
In addition to flexible time off, we honor 12 paid holidays annually on average. And we close the office between Christmas Eve and New Year's day to recharge each year.
Phone & internet stipends
Many of our employees work from home or on the go. So we offer full time employees a monthly stipend to cover for phone and internet costs.
